学号: 201371020118 2015 年 6月 18日
系别 | 计算机 | 专业 | 软件工程 | 班级 | 软件1班 | 姓名 | 龙桂全 | |||||||||
课程名称 | 数据库原理试验 | 课程类型 | 必修 | 学时数 | 2 | |||||||||||
实验名称 | Power Designer概念模型设计及逻辑结构、物理结构生成 | |||||||||||||||
试验要求: 1.掌握Power Designer概念模型设计方法 2.掌握由CDM向PDM转换 试验内容: 1.用Power Designer设计概念模型 (1)点击File,选择NEW Model命令,弹出下面的界面: (2)在上面的界面中,点击Model typels选Conceptual Data Model,然后在下方的Model name ,填写CDM模型名称,最后点击“确定”按钮。 (3)单击设计元素面板上的Entity(实体)工具,将鼠标放在设计区域的合适位置,单击鼠标左键,就创建了一个实体。右击鼠标,释放Entity工具。 (4)General选择卡设置通用属性,Attributes选择卡设置实体包含的属性,Identifiers设置实体的码,Notes记录备注信息,Rules设置规则,其中前两个必须设置,其余的选择设置。如图:
(5)选择General选择卡,在设置Name的属性为student,Code与Name相同即可。 (6)选择Attributes选择卡,设置该实体所包含的属性,Name列设置属性名称,Code列设置属性的代码,Tyde列设置该属性的数据类型,Domain列设置属性的域,M和P列设置属性的约束,M为强制非空的,P为设置该属性是主键的属性,D为该属性显示。 (7)选择Identifiers,在此设置主、次标示符。主标识符只能有一个,但次标示符可有多个。在设置实体的属性时,选出主标示符,则系统自动生成主标示符。如下图: (8)单击Add a Row 按钮,系统自动生产,修改Name,点击应用。接下来设置标示符属性,选择次标示符的行号,双击出现设置窗口,在General中设置Name与Code,在Attributes中,单击Add Attributes 按钮,出现student的属性列表,从中选择次标示符,最后单击OK按钮。 (9)设置规则,选择Rules选择卡(第六页) 单击Create an Object工具,出现以下界面: (10) 此界面中,Ceneral设置规则名,Expression中输入规则内容。 至此,实体的所有属性都设置完了,在设置完每一个属性后,都要点击“应用”按钮。 2.由CDM向PDM转换 (1)在CDM设计界面上选择Tools,再选择Check Model命令,检查CMD的正确性,如果存在错误,检查改正。 (2)在CDM没有错误的情况下,在CDM界面选择Tools,接着选择Generate Physical Model,出现PDM Generation Options对话框。在Generate选项中,设置转换生成PDM的基本属性。 (3)选择File下面的Save命令,保存PDM,如图。 | ||||||||||||||||
试验总结: 在本次试验中基本掌握了用Power Designer设计概念模型的方法,以及由概念模型生成物理模型的方法,比直接设计物理模型有很大的节省时间!为以后更加快捷的做实验打下了基础。 | ||||||||||||||||
成绩 | 批阅教师 | 批阅日期 |